Journey Risk & Safe-Route Navigation

Drivers on high-exposure routes need more than shortest-path navigation: hazards, road conditions, restricted stretches, safe parking and emergency facilities must shape the route and active guidance.

The Mappls response

Connect real-world, enterprise and operational data to the intelligence and workflow that create the outcome

Journey risk assessment using map, survey and RealView evidence; risk-categorized route stretches and safe-route models; driver navigation with contextual voice alerts and controlled rerouting; adherence, exception and after-action dashboards.

Proof of value

De-risk the programme with a bounded, outcome-led proof

Model representative routes, validate hazards and safe facilities, publish safe routes to a driver app, simulate deviations and unavailable stretches, and review adherence in the control tower.
